How to prepare for a job interview at British Gas

Know Your Stuff

Make sure you brush up on your technical knowledge related to heating systems and electrical work. Familiarise yourself with the latest technologies and practices in the industry, as this will show your passion and commitment to the role.

Show Your Team Spirit

Since the company values teamwork, be prepared to discuss your experiences working in teams. Share examples of how you've collaborated with others to achieve common goals, especially in challenging situations.

Emphasise Your Commitment to Sustainability

Given the company's focus on creating a greener future, highlight any experience or knowledge you have regarding sustainable practices in the energy sector. This could include energy efficiency measures or renewable energy solutions.

Ask Thoughtful Questions

Prepare some insightful questions about the company's initiatives and culture. This not only shows your interest but also helps you determine if the company aligns with your values and career aspirations.
